acreativepage:

...Do you agree that sales might be lost due to the way Google is set up?

No. I believe that lost customers occur long before the payment page ever comes up. What I mean is...

When I arrive at an online store, I make some initial decisions about whether I want to shop there based on professionalism and organization of the store itself. If the store has professionally made graphics and template, well written privacy and about us pages, fair shipping and return policies, and no broken links or revolving doors to nowhere, then they are okay...so far. I don't like to see banner ads and confusing specials all over a store either.

Then I size up the selection and price offerings of their merchandise. If the descriptions and pictures are crystal clear and informative, then I feel safer. If anything did not scare me away by now I am feeling more confident. If they have exactly what I was looking for, I may take the leap.

By the time I arrive at the payment page, I have already made the decision to buy and my credit card is out of my wallet. As long as the payment methods are at least ones that I have heard good things about, I would give them a try. The fact that I get sent to Google to log in actually makes me feel safer because they are a household name all over the world.

You wouldn't have lost MY sale because of GCO.
